What’s Merriam-Webster’s word of the year for 2016?

“Surreal.”

The dictionary publishers said, in a release, that searches for the word peaked three noticeable times throughout the year — the largest and latest surge was right after the 2016 U.S. election.

Other words in the running included “Bigly” and “deplorables”.
